Solved

how to display cart details in a campaign email

  • 19 April 2023
  • 8 replies
  • 150 views

Badge +2

Hi,  I ran a sale on my shopify store last week.   The sale has ended.  

I am creating a segment that includes people that has abandoned the checkout process last week.  I’d like to send them an email giving them a discount to recover the abandoned cart.  

So should I use an email campaign to do that?  If so, how can I include the cart content in my email?

or should I create a one-time flow to include this one-week abandoned carts?


I already have an abandoned cart recovery flow, but that’s not specific to this group of abandoned carts.

icon

Best answer by stephen.trumble 20 April 2023, 15:22

View original

8 replies

Userlevel 7
Badge +60

Hey @noobmarket 

Thanks for reaching out for help with your abandon cart email.

The best way to achieve this would be to set up a one time flow. In order to pull in the correct data you will need to use one of the prebuilt abandon cart flow templates or create a metric triggered flow using Add to cart as the trigger, you can then add flow filters to limit the audience you are pulling from. Metric triggered flow are the only way to dynamically populate the email template with the correct information. 

Hope this helps!

Badge +2

I set up this flow to capture all the abandoned carts during the last promotion between April 1st and 16th.

I back-populated the flow recipients.  But there’s no one entering this flow.  How should I fix it?

 

Userlevel 7
Badge +60

Hey @noobmarket 

I would suggest removing the flow trigger filter $Value is greater than 0, any profile that has a Checkout Started will automatically be greater than 0. The flow filters shouldn’t be the issue as none of them are contradicting each other.

Badge +2

I removed the flow trigger filter $Value is greater than 0.

But there’s no one entering this flow after I backpopulated the flow. 

Userlevel 7
Badge +60

Hey @noobmarket 

I knew I was missing a major piece of information for you but I just figured it out! I’m so sorry for my confusion. Check out this other community post with the same issue: 

Thank you so much for your patience, and sorry again for my confusion!

Badge +2

@stephen.trumble , thanks for the link to the similar issue discussion.

Because I wanted to target abandoned checkout since 4/1/2023, I added a time day of 24 days and successfully got the backpopulation to work:

 

But I have a new problem where the emails are scheduled to go out like 24 days from the time the users started the checkout.

But I want to schedule these emails to go out as soon as possible as the flow is a one-time effort trying to recover abandoned carts.

I understand that I can create a segment to target these emails with a campaign, but I can’t display a user’s cart in a campaign email.

 

Userlevel 7
Badge +44

@noobmarket,

You could try to create a segment and have the flow trigger on people being in that segment. That way you can sent it out in one go. You could also just send it as a campaign if you'd like.

 

Omar Lovert // Polaris Growth // Klaviyo Master Platinum Partner

We help with e-commerce growth through CRO, Klaviyo and CVO

Badge +2

But how can I show the cart content in the email if I use a segment-triggered flow?

Reply